Independent & Foreign Films
American Hangman
(Unrated) Tale of vigilante
justice about a judge
(Donald Sutherland)
who is kidnapped and
put on trial live over the
internet after botching a
criminal case. With Vincent Kartheiser,
Oliver Dennis and Paul Braunstein.
Being Rose (Unrated) Cybill Sheherd
handles the title role in this romance
drama as a wheelchair-bound widow
who falls in love with an elderly cowboy
(James Brolin) while traveling solo
across the Southwest. Cast features
Pam Grier, Amy Davidson and Cindy
Pickett.
Great Great Great (Unrated) Romance
drama about a couple (Dan Beirne and
Sarah Kolasky) whose blissful relationship
starts to fall apart when they
finally get engaged after being together
for five years. Support cast includes
Richard Clarkin, Lindsay Leese and Ian
Fisher.
Mojin: The Worm Valley (Unrated)
Action-oriented sequel based on Luo
Xiao’s best-selling series of novels finds
a team of explorers embarking on a perilous
expedition in search of an ancient
emperor’s tomb located on a faraway
island infested with treacherous monsters.
Co-starring Cai Heng, Gu Xuan
and Cheng Taishen. (In Mandarin with
subtitles)
Kam’s Kapsules
By Kam Williams
Rust Creek (R for profanity, violence
and drug use) Harrowing tale of survival
about an ambitious college senior
(Hermione Corfield) who finds herself
pursued by a gang of bloodthirsty outlaws
through the Kentucky backwoods
after taking a wrong turn on her way to
a job interview. With Jay Paulson, Sean
O’Bryan and Jeremy Glazer.
State Like Sleep (Unrated) Suspense
thriller revolving around a young widow
(Katherine Waterston) who receives an
unsettling phone call directing her
return to Brussels to unravel the mystery
of her husband’s (Michiel Huisman)
untimely death. Cast includes
Michael Shannon, Luke Evans and
Mary Kay Place.
The Vanishing (R for violence and
profanity) Fact-based thriller set on
a tiny Scottish isle where three lighthouse
keepers (Gerard Butler, Peter
Mullan and Connor Swindells) vanish
without a trace after finding a
treasure chest filled with gold aboard
a shipwrecked rowboat. With Olafur
Darri Olafsson, Gary Lewis and Emma
King.
